Transaction 3873e512232cf986d5f19cbc49d18e1316e7551682e96e7bfe0c571d0aef5ab5
1 Input
1 Output
-
3873e512232cf986d5f19cbc49d18e1316e7551682e96e7bfe0c571d0aef5ab5:0
- value
- 1027223
- script pubkey
- OP_0 OP_PUSHBYTES_32 270cda30ac93de8fd1770e0f54817bf386a35a12ee2d9ed9f71084add10b261d
- address
- bc1qyuxd5v9vj00gl5thpc84fqtm7wr2xksjackeak0hzzz2m5gtycwsyru602